Frequently Asked 'Electrical Service' Questions

How much do electrical services cost in Hartford County, CT?

Electrical services in Hartford County, Connecticut, typically cost $75–$150 per hour for licensed electricians, with most professionals charging $95–$125 during regular business hours. Service call fees range from $100–$300 and often include the first hour of diagnostics. Simple electrical repairs like outlet replacement average $160–$350, while medium projects such as ceiling fan installation cost $300–$700. Major electrical work including panel upgrades ranges from $1,500–$4,000, and whole-house rewiring can cost $8,000–$15,000. Emergency electrical services cost 50–100% more than standard rates, with weekend and holiday premiums typically applied.

Yes, most electrical work in Connecticut requires permits from local building departments to ensure safety and code compliance. Licensed electrical contractors typically handle permit applications, which cost $40–$250 depending on your Hartford County municipality and project scope. Permits are required for new circuits, panel upgrades, rewiring, outlet additions, and any work involving electrical connections to the main service. Simple repairs like replacing existing switches or outlets with identical units typically do not require permits. Unpermitted electrical work can void insurance coverage and create safety hazards.

Common signs indicating electrical work is needed include flickering or dimming lights when appliances start, frequent circuit breaker trips without obvious overloads, burning smells from outlets or panels, warm electrical outlets or switch plates, and buzzing sounds from electrical components. Homes over 30 years old often need electrical updates, especially those with original wiring, fuse boxes instead of circuit breakers, or aluminum wiring installed in the 1960s–70s. These conditions pose fire and electrocution risks requiring immediate professional electrical assessment in Hartford County, Connecticut.

Yes, Connecticut requires all electricians to hold state electrical licenses issued by the Department of Consumer Protection (DCP), with separate licensing for residential and commercial work. Reputable Hartford County electrical contractors carry comprehensive liability insurance ($500,000–$2,000,000) and workers’ compensation coverage to protect customers from property damage and injury claims. Licensed electricians must complete continuing education and pass state examinations demonstrating electrical code knowledge. Always verify license status through Connecticut’s eLicense website and request certificates of insurance before beginning work.

Electrical emergencies requiring immediate professional attention in Connecticut include sparking outlets or switches, burning smells from electrical components, electrical panels that feel warm to the touch, and any situation involving electrical shock. Power outages affecting only your home, exposed wiring, water contact with electrical systems, and circuit breakers that won’t stay reset also constitute emergencies. These conditions can cause house fires or electrocution.Turn off main electrical power if safe to do so, evacuate if there’s a burning smell, and never attempt DIY repairs on emergency electrical situations.
